Hawkweed Marble vs Mandarin Vole
Celypha rurestrana compared with Lasiopodomys mandarinus
Taxonomic Classification
| Rank | Hawkweed Marble | Mandarin Vole |
|---|---|---|
| Kingdom same | Animalia (Animals) | Animalia (Animals) |
| Phylum | Arthropoda (Arthropods) | Chordata (Chordates) |
| Class | Insecta (Insects) | Mammalia (Mammals) |
| Order | Lepidoptera (Butterflies & Moths) | Rodentia (Rodents) |
| Family | Tortricidae | Cricetidae |
| Genus | Celypha | Lasiopodomys |
| Species | Celypha rurestrana | Lasiopodomys mandarinus |
Evolutionary Relationship
Hawkweed Marble and Mandarin Vole share a common ancestor at the Kingdom level: Animalia. (Animals)
